DetailsAs per 2014 GDP data, Arunachal is third from below, placing it as one of the poorest states in terms of the economy. Agriculture is the primary source of the economy. And the traditional method followed, known as Jhum, is practised in most regions even to this day. Some of the things grown include rice, millet, pulses, potatoes and oilseeds.

DetailsArunachal Pradesh is a north-eastern state of India also known as the "Land of the rising sun" or "Land of the Dawn-Lit Mountains".The name Arunachal comes from – 'Arun' means sun and 'achal' means to rise.. The state borders Burma / Myanmar in the east, Bhutan in the west, Tibet in the north, Assam in the south, and Nagaland in the southeast.
